We are taking part in the 2.6 Challenge to save the UKs charities and fundraise for our activities for autism/additional needs families so that we can get back up and running when able to do so.
As you can imagine, these are difficult times for charities as it is not possible to fundraise in the usual manner. In the past we have received donations via shows, pantomime, carnival, fetes, sponsored activities etc. This year we are the chosen charity for the Senior Section at Blacknest Golf Club - but of course golfing is off for the time being.
We need to continue fundraising so that we can get back up and running our activities (Saturday Zones, Fun Zones, Teen Zones and our Zone Outs) once it is possible to do so. Our sessions are for local families with children with autism or similar additional needs. It is often difficult for them to get the children out and joining in with mainstream activities. Once we are all able to take part in social activities again, our sessions will be needed more than ever so that families can come along, get support, connect with others and feel relaxed and accepted with their children joining in and having fun.
